Vidyavardhaka Law College, known for its well-rounded approach for providing education particularly in the law domain, was established in 1974, It is the most respected law institution in Karnataka, which is managed by Vidyavardhaka Sangha. The college is recognised by the Bar Council of India (BCI). VLC Mysore offers an educational atmosphere and ensures accessibility and all-round development for aspiring law professionals.
Vidyavardhaka Law College offers full-time undergraduate law programmes. These programmes include a three-year LLB and the five-year integrated BA LLB course. Since the college is affiliated to Karnataka State Law University (KSLU), Hubballi, the admissions are based on merit in the 10+2 level. Vidyavardhaka Law College is centrally located at Seshadri Iyer Road, Mysore, Karnataka – 570001. The Private Bus Stand-Mysore and Old RMC Private Bus Stand are very close to the college. The nearest major railway station is Mysuru Junction (MYS). It is a significant railway hub with connections to various major cities. The closest airport is Mysuru Airport (MYQ), also known as Mandakalli Airport.

Vidyavardhaka Law College, Mysore provides an opportunity to its students to apply for and to avail various Scholarships. Vidyavardhaka Law College has established a Minority Cell which is a special cell that works with an aim for the welfare of the minority students. The Minority Cell at Vidyavardhaka Law College, Mysore communicates the information regarding various Scholarships and various Schemes which are being provided by the Central Government, State Government and other Institutions. The Minority Cell at Vidyavardhaka Law College co- ordinate through the University with the Government and the UGC to get Scholarships/Freeships and other Financial Benefits for the minority category students.
The students at Vidyavardhaka Law College, Mysore who want to apply for the Scholarships are required to submit all the necessary documents to the College Authorities and only after the verification of the documents by the College Authorities, the students at Vidyavardhaka Law College can avail the Scholarships.

Vidyavardhaka Law College admissions are offered at the undergraduate level only. VLC Mysore admissions are offered in 2 courses, which are a 3-year LLB course and the other one is an integrated 5-year BA LLB course.
VLC Mysore admissions at both the undergraduate programmes are conducted in accordance with Karnataka State Law University (KSLU), Hubballi guidelines and Bar Council of India requirements. Admissions to these VLS Mysore courses are done on the basis of merit in qualifying examinations. Vidyavardhaka Law College is on Seshadri Iyer Road, Mysore – 570001. It’s close to the Private Bus Stand and Old RMC Bus Stand, about 2 km from Mysuru Junction railway station, and approximately 10 km from Mysuru Airport.
VLC Mysore provides a moot court hall, legal aid clinic, seminar rooms, well-equipped classrooms, high-speed internet, and a library stocked with law books and journals. Canteen services and student common areas ensure a comfortable campus environment.
The three-year LLB programme spans six semesters, while the BA LLB runs for ten semesters. Fee structures are set by the state university and typically reviewed annually, applicants should consult VLC Mysore’s admissions office for the latest fee details.
Admissions to both LLB and BA LLB at VLC Mysore are merit-based. Candidates must have passed 10+2 (for BA LLB) or a bachelor’s degree (for LLB) with the required minimum marks, as specified by KSLU and the college.
Vidyavardhaka Law College, Mysore offers a three-year LLB programme and a five-year integrated BA LLB course. Both are full-time, Bar Council of India–approved, and affiliated with Karnataka State Law University, Hubballi.
